  • The wrestling team is still hanging around in the top-ten in a couple of polls.

Seth Gross is No. 1 at 133 pounds, Tristan Moran is No. 11 at 141, Cole Martin is No. 14 at 149, Evan Wick is No. 3 at 165 and Trent Hilger is the No. 8 heavyweight in the country according to FloWrestling.

Using data collected at knowrivalry.com, its clear that Ohioans only have one team on the brain, and it’s exactly who you would expect. Fans collectively decided to allocate 90.71 out of 100 “rivalry points” to the Wolverines. That doesn’t leave a lot for any one else. And yet, Penn State doesn’t even register as second on the hate scale, that honor going to Wisconsin. Penn State came in third at a measly 3.51 points.
